istanbul怎么使用
时间: 2024-04-28 11:25:16 浏览: 8
Istanbul可以用于很多不同的方面,以下是一些示例:
1. 作为旅游目的地,您可以参观伊斯坦布尔的许多博物馆、清真寺、宫殿和其他文化景点,例如圣索菲亚大教堂、蓝色清真寺、托普卡帕宫等等。
2. 作为商业中心,伊斯坦布尔是土耳其的经济和金融中心,您可以在这里找到许多国际公司和商业机会。
3. 作为教育中心,伊斯坦布尔有许多著名的大学,例如博格阿齐奥大学、伊斯坦布尔大学等等。
4. 作为居住地,伊斯坦布尔拥有许多不同的住房选项,从公寓到别墅都有,您可以选择适合自己的居住环境。
总之,伊斯坦布尔是一个多功能的城市,可以满足不同人群的不同需求。
相关问题
code coverage插件使用lcov的那种格式进行分析3
如果您想使用lcov格式进行代码覆盖率分析,您需要使用支持lcov格式的代码覆盖率插件。例如,对于JavaScript项目,您可以使用istanbul和codecov插件来生成和分析lcov格式的代码覆盖率报告。
以下是如何使用istanbul和codecov插件来生成和分析lcov格式的代码覆盖率报告的步骤:
1. 安装istanbul和codecov插件:
```
npm install --save-dev istanbul codecov
```
2. 在package.json文件中添加以下脚本:
```
{
"scripts": {
"test": "istanbul cover ./node_modules/mocha/bin/_mocha",
"report-coverage": "codecov"
}
}
```
3. 运行测试代码,并生成lcov格式的代码覆盖率报告:
```
npm run test
```
这将生成一个名为coverage/lcov.info的lcov格式的代码覆盖率报告。
4. 将代码覆盖率报告上传到codecov:
```
npm run report-coverage
```
这将上传代码覆盖率报告到codecov,可以在codecov网站上查看和分析。
请注意,这只是一个简单的示例,您可以根据您的项目需要进行更改。
vscode中coverage code 没有覆盖的行怎么显示
在 VS Code 中,你可以使用一些代码覆盖率工具来查看代码中未被覆盖的行。其中最常用的是 Istanbul,这是一个 JavaScript 代码覆盖率工具,可以与 VS Code 集成以进行代码覆盖率分析。
要在 VS Code 中使用 Istanbul,你需要按照以下步骤进行操作:
1. 在项目中安装 Istanbul:
```
npm install --save-dev istanbul
```
2. 在项目中添加一个 script 脚本来运行 Istanbul:
```
"scripts": {
"test": "istanbul cover ./node_modules/mocha/bin/_mocha --reporter spec"
}
```
这个脚本将使用 Istanbul 覆盖你的项目,并使用 Mocha 测试框架来运行测试。
3. 运行测试并生成覆盖率报告:
```
npm test
```
4. 生成的覆盖率报告将被保存在 `coverage/` 目录下。你可以在 VS Code 中打开该目录,并查看 `index.html` 文件以查看代码覆盖率报告。在报告中,未被覆盖的行将以红色突出显示。
请注意,这只是一种使用 Istanbul 进行代码覆盖率分析的方法。如果你使用其他代码覆盖率工具,则可能需要采取不同的方法来查看未被覆盖的行。